The Chimay Blue is a dark ale with a powerful aroma. Its complex flavor improves with passing time. The 75-centiliter version (since 1982) is called ''Grande Réserve'' because of its great storage potential., It was first brewed as a Christmas beer by the monks of Scourmont Abbey in 1956. But after its great success, it was decided to offer it permanently.
